I went to Kennedy's for breakfast with a friend today and had a very positive experience.

I was treating a friend to her 70th birthday breakfast. She has very limited mobility so a short walk from the car was essential. I enquired if this was available and was told that it was - there are two wheelchair spaces about six steps from the table...perfect!

While on this email back-and-forth, I was asked if I'd like to book which I did. When I arrived I explained I had booked and was replied to with "Oh! You must be Amy!" A lovely friendly greeting.

The two ladies who served us were friendly and helpful. The menu was pretty standard breakfast but all the food we saw sailing past to other people looked good too. My friend had pancakes which I was assured were gorgeous and I had granola. I thought the portion looked a bit excessive but I managed to finish it all. It was delicious - nutty flavour - and the rhubarb was perfect with it. (I should add that I ate that around 9am and it's now 6pm and I'm only now starting to feel a little hungry - it has literally kept me going all day).

The coffee wasn't to my taste - just a personal preference but the teas were lovely.

It was an important day for us and the real winner was that we didn't at all feel rushed. We sat outside and chatted for about two hours, watching the world go by, and nobody tried to make us order more or move us along which was very much appreciated.

All in all for our two breakfasts with tea and coffee it was under €25 so it's excellent value (especially as it covered breakfast...

This is a lovely spot to treat yourself to a great cappuccino, scones or even some savory dishes. I have tried multiple things at various occasions and have never been disappointed. Staff is generally lovely and forthcoming. They also sell some of their products like carrot hummus - which is definitely one of my favorite picks. They do have a daily changing meal, so it can't get boring at all! Today I had a cappuccino, scones with blueberry & apple, and the avocado toast, which was delicious.

Busy place full of locals. Tasty food and coffee. Sometimes cleanliness of the tables is not to the highest of standards. You can only pay there by card, no cash allowed. Be prepared that they serve certain food at certain time so if you arrive at breakfast, don't be looking for anything from the lunch menu.
